Voting rights denied for post-commencement creditors – implications

0
The recent decision by the Gauteng High Court denoting that creditors who have acquired their claim in a business after business rescue has commenced are not entitled to vote on business rescue plans could set a significantly risky precedent for any future organisations facing business rescue.

Insolvency – the impact of distressed corporates & director apathy

0
An issue which is of concern to insolvency practitioners across the globe and in South Africa, is the ever increasing level of corporate distress and uncertainty, and which impacts the role of insolvency practitioners (liquidators and business rescue practitioners) and the manner in which they can assist in the restructuring of companies that might be on the brink of insolvency.
